Opus 1.14 works just fine. - --- msged 1.99L MSC * Origin: Silver Bullet - Silver Spring, Md. - 301-622-2247 (1:109/417) ------------------------------ Date: 21 Jan 91 08:21 -0500 From: FRANK MALLORY To: GEORGE THEALL Subject: HARD DISK PROBLEM GT> There's a utility for PCs from Sam Smith called DTEST. It runs thru GT> a disk sector by sector and displays a message if either a sector is GT> bad or simply "slow" (sectors which read properly but require retries). GT> The author explains these "slow" sectors are more likely to fail than GT> other sectors. That could be what you're experiencing. GT> Look for DTST20.ZIP at a site near you.
